Why Choose Composite Doors For Your Front Door Replacement?

The doors to your home are a vital component of the security system of your home. They must therefore be strong and long lasting.

A front entry door made of composite is a fantastic option for those who want to be durable. They are resistant to rotting, warping or swelling.

They are more efficient in terms of energy consumption.

It is essential to select front doors that are as energy efficient as is possible to lower household expenses. Unlike traditional timber or uPVC alternatives, composite doors offer superior energy efficiency and improved thermal properties. This keeps your home warm and cozy throughout the year, and saves you money on your energy bills.

The interior space of the composite door is filled with warm thermal polyurethane foam insulation that helps reduce the energy transfer and dramatically improve your home's energy efficiency. The doors are also manufactured to exact measurements, ensuring that they are snugly inserted into the frame and eliminate drafts.

Another advantage of composite doors is that they're much easier to maintain than other types of front doors. They do not require regular sanding or repainting as timber or uPVC This means they'll last for longer. They also resist scratches and stains. They're an excellent choice for homeowners who wish to enhance their home's appearance without spending hours on maintenance.

They're windproof, won't shrink or warp during rain, and they don't shrink when it's hot. This makes them a good investment for your home. Moreover, they're resistant to rot and rust and won't need to be replaced as wooden or uPVC alternatives.

They're more durable

If there's something that differentiates composite doors from other options for replacing front doors they're their durability. They can withstand severe wear and damage, bumps and knocks, and they aren't likely become brittle or start to shrink as quickly as uPVC or timber. This makes them an excellent option for homes with children or pets, as they will be capable of enduring a lot of abuse and still look brand new.

They're also more secure than other replacement doors because of the numerous layers of material. This makes them extremely difficult to get into, since there aren't any weak points that burglars could exploit. In addition the locking mechanisms on composite doors are stronger and more secure than those on traditional wooden doors, making them a great deterrent to burglars.

In addition to their long-lasting composite door replacement lock doors are also less prone to weather damage. They won't rot or warp like timber, and won't be damaged by wind or rain. They are also easy to maintain as they do not require resealing or regular repainting. They can be cleaned with a damp cloth or sponge.

Finally composite front door Replacement doors are more energy efficient than other types of front doors. They have lower U values than uPVC, timber, and aluminium front doors, which keep your home warm and reduces your energy bills. If you're environmentally-minded, you can even choose to purchase a composite door that's made from recycled plastic components.

Although composite doors are more expensive than uPVC and timber alternatives, they'll last for a long time, often up to 30 years. This means they're an investment that will save you money on heating and maintenance expenses in the years to come. A composite front door is the most suitable choice for homeowners who are looking for an extremely durable door.
